2009-02-20igb: Add support for enabling VFs to PF driver.Alexander Duyck
This patch adds the support to handle requests from the VF to perform operations such as completing resets, setting/reading mac address, adding vlans, adding multicast addresses, setting rlpml, and general communications between the PF and all VFs.
